Four times a year, the college organizes market fairs in cooperation with

surrounding villages and to promote the different products from the farms.

SURAFCO II Output 1: Upland Partner Networking & Capacity

Outreach

In January 2014, students & teachers of the Forestry Division attended a training on REDD+, in cooperation with GIZ to

discuss deforastation in Laos

Study Visit to Hanoi University of Agriculture to learn about paddy rice

production

In 2014, the Outreach and Agro-Business Division capture videos of college’s

Graduates. The video profiles focus on graduates working with the private sector and

in self-employment

Meeting on common working goals between NAFC Luang Prabang and the Agriculture

and Forestry College in Bolikhamxay

SURAFCO II Output 2: Good Education Quality relevant for the

Uplands

Graduation of Upgrading Students of the Agronomy Division in March 2014

Upgrading Training for teachers from the Agronomy, Livestock and Agribusiness

Division on Medical Plants and Medicine Making at the Traditional Medicinal Institute

in Vientiane

Students learning how to measure contour lines and to calculate the slope at the

NAFC Upland Farm. Contour Cropping reduces erosion in Uplands.

Members of NAFC MIC Team are learning about water sewage systems and

maintenance at Maejo University in Chiang Mai, Thailand

SURAFCO II Output 3: Transparent, effective and gender-sensitive College

Management

New Dormitories have been built near the Sports ground and canteen to offer modern accommodation for the increasing numbers

of students at NAFC

Female Staff of NAFC receive their certificates for successful training on

accounting and finances

NAFC students contribute to Blood Donation Day organized by Lao Red Cross. At the same time, students’ health condition is

checked

Teachers of Outreach and Agribusiness Divisions visit a graduate from NAFC. With the skills gained in his studies, he was able to start an own vegetable farm in Oudomxay

Province.

SURAFCO II Output 4: Increased Employment of Graduates

supporting Upland Development

First year students fill in the pre-tracer study, which serves as a data-base for

following up the students after their graduation.

During their Practical Term on the NAFC Medicinal Plant Farm, students visit Pha

Tad Ke Botanical Garden in Luang Prabang. Medicinal Plants have a high

potential for income generation.

One task of the Career Counseling Section is to offer individual advice on employment

needs.
